Identifying hidden leaks can be a challenging task, often leaving homeowners and businesses scratching their heads. These elusive water problems can manifest in unexpected ways, leading to increased water bills and potential damage to your property. However, with a methodical approach and the right tools, you can triumphantly pinpoint those hidden leaks and bring them under control.

  • Begin by carefully inspecting your pipes for any visible signs of leakage, such as water stains, rust, or dampness.
  • Inspect your bathroom fixtures for leaks by placing a few drops of food coloring in the tank and observing if it appears in the bowl without flushing.
  • Think about using a leak detection tool, which can send out sound waves to identify hidden leaks within your walls or floors.

Identifying Water Loss: Effective Leak Detection Techniques

A significant percentage of water loss in homes and businesses is often due to undetected leaks. These hidden situations can cause considerable damage and lead to hefty water bills if left unaddressed. Fortunately, there are several effective techniques for identifying water leaks, ranging from simple visual inspections to more sophisticated technological approaches.

One of the first actions in leak detection is a thorough visual examination of your property. Look for signs of water damage such as mildew on walls, ceilings, or floors. Pay attention to areas around plumbing fixtures, appliances, and water connections.

If you suspect a leak, consider using a moisture meter to pinpoint its location. These gadgets can detect even the smallest amounts of moisture in walls, floors, and ceilings.

In some cases, a professional plumber may be needed to detect leaks that are difficult to find. They utilize specialized equipment such as acoustic leak detectors or dye testing to accurately pinpoint the source of the problem.

Promptly addressing water leaks is essential to prevent further damage and conserve precious water resources. By implementing effective leak detection strategies, you can safeguard your property and reduce unnecessary water waste.
